Harry took a loan from the bank.

Answer:

The size of Harry's loan is $9000.

Step-by-step explanation:

D(t) models Harry's remaining debt, in dollars, as a function of time t, in months  that is given by :

D(t) =-200t+ 9000

We can see 200 is in negative that means it is getting deducted from the function. So, Harry must be paying this each month against his loan.

Lets put t = 0, that shows no payments have been made.

This will get the amount of loan, before any payments.

D(t)=-200(0)+9000

So,D(t) =9000

Hence, the size of Harry's loan is $9000.

What is not equivalent to 50/75. is it 10/15 or 2/3 or 5/7 or 6/9?
Liula [17]
50/75 reduces to 2/3

10/15 reduces to 2/3
2/3 is 2/3
6/9 = 2/3

5/7 will not reduce

so ur answer is 5/7
